Many of the country's best skiers come from Vermont. A few notable Alpine Skiing Olympic Medalists include William "Billy" Kidd, born in Burlington, Vermont; Andrea Lawrence, born in Rutland County, Vermont; and Barbara Cochran, born in Richmond, Vermont.
